Wheels on the bus

This weekend Gillian was sitting at the table and was looking for her baby doll. I asked her what baby says and she replied “wah wah wah!” It took me a minute to realize that she must have learned the song “The Wheels on the Bus.” I sang the song and Gillian immediately started making hand motions to go along with the lyrics. She rolled her hands for the wheels. And then she put her hands in a V and said “all through the town!” It got better not only did she rub her eyes for the crying baby, but she made her arms go swish swish for the wipers. She sang the song for the rest of the day.

Now whenever there is a lull in conversation, she will start singing. She sang the entire car ride home today. I just need to teach her a new song. There are only so many times you can sing “The Wheels on the Bus.”
